Tara’s yoga journey started in her college days at the local community college. Finding no real interest in the history or concept of yoga, it was merely another way to get in shape. Years later, after working in the service industry and not taking care of her body or mind, Tara found vinyasa style flow yoga.

It didn’t take long for the yoga to kick start something inside Tara– she knew within a year she was meant to teach yoga to others. The practice allowed her to discover more about not only her body, but about herself. In exploring the poses with breath work, the world opens up a dimension of your life that is missing your not even aware it existed. She completed her 200 hour certification last year and continues her education attending workshops around the country; including Off the Mat- Into the World ‘s Leadership Training. Her teaching style incorporates a bit of fun and the idea of fearlessness — a willingness to be open — and an emphasis on alignment. Having dealt with lower back pain throughout her practice, she believes in slowing the practice down to deeper understand your body and breath.
